Why AI Search Demands a New Approach to Content Architecture
AI answer engines like Google Bard, Bing Chat, and others increasingly source responses from pages they consider high-experience and trustworthy. The signals overlap heavily with traditional SEO, but AI also weighs content structure, clarity, and compliance much more explicitly.
In regulated verticals like crypto and fintech, the cost of missteps is high. Misleading claims or insufficient disclosures can trigger policy penalties or worse. This means your content must satisfy three pillars:
- AEO: Audience Experience Optimization, ensuring content matches user intent clearly, answers questions precisely, and delivers an easy-on-the-eyes format.
- GEO: Google Experience Optimization, focusing on E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ness), structured data, and compliance signals.
- Regulatory Alignment: Transparent, accurate claims, clear disclaimers, and policy-safe language.
The interplay between AEO and GEO becomes your competitive moat. Ignore it, and your content risks being invisible or untrusted by AI engines and users alike.
Starting Point: Mapping Your Content for AEO and GEO Success
The foundation of effective AI-search content architecture is a well-structured content map aligned to user journeys, regulatory requirements, and AI needs. Most teams fail here because they either silo compliance from marketing or treat content as SEO keyword stuffing.
Practical steps:
- Segment your audience by intent: For example, crypto investors vs. institutional partners vs. developers have different questions and regulatory sensitivity.
- Identify key content pillars: Educational guides, compliance disclosures, product deep-dives, case studies, and FAQs.
- Define content tiers: Use a hierarchy with cornerstone pages (foundational), cluster content (supporting topics), and focused long-tail pages that answer specific questions.
- Integrate regulatory checkpoints: Each content piece must pass compliance review before publication.
This approach enables AI to understand your site as a reliable knowledge source and helps users move smoothly down the funnel.
Crafting AI-Optimized Content Formats for Regulated Verticals
Length and format matter. AI engines favor content that’s both concise and comprehensive. Bombarding users with walls of text or vague jargon kills AEO and GEO signals.
Here’s what works:
- FAQ sections: AI loves structured Q&As. Frame questions both broadly and with specific regulatory nuances.
- Step-by-step guides: Break down complex processes, e.g., "How to complete KYC safely in crypto trading."
- Tables and checklists: These improve scannability and AI readability.
- Clear disclaimers and policy statements: Always front-load regulatory info to build trust.
Avoid fluff or generic SaaS phrases. Keep your language direct, jargon-light, and focused on real-world user benefits.
Practical AEO and GEO Checklist for Regulated Content
| Aspect | Action Point |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Intent Alignment | Map content to precise user questions | Use search data and customer interviews to refine |
| Structured Data | Implement schema for FAQs, articles, disclaimers | Helps AI engines parse and cite your content accurately |
| E-E-A-T Signals | Showcase author expertise and compliance credentials | Use author bios, external citations, verified credentials |
| Compliance Integration | Embed disclaimers, update per jurisdiction | Regular legal audits mandatory |
| Content Format | Use tables, bullet points, and headers to break text | Improves readability and AI comprehension |
| Internal Linking | Link cornerstone content to clusters | Builds topical authority and helps AI crawl your site effectively |
| Update Frequency | Refresh content periodically to reflect policy changes | Keeps content fresh and compliant, signals trustworthiness |
Internal Linking: The Glue That Connects AEO and GEO
Internal linking is often overlooked, but it’s the backbone of AI-search content architecture. For regulated verticals, linking isn’t just about SEO juice. It’s about showing content relationships and compliance context.
Tip: Link compliance pages from all product and educational content. This reassures AI engines and users that your site is policy-safe. Likewise, connect high-level guides to niche FAQs so AI understands content depth.
This approach also improves crawlability and helps performance marketing teams track funnel flow.
Operational Challenges and Tradeoffs
You might be thinking: this sounds resource-heavy. It is. Building compliant, AI-optimized content architecture takes coordination between marketing, legal, product, and SEO teams. Prioritization is essential.
Tradeoffs include:
- Speed vs Compliance: Rapid content launches risk errors. Build robust review workflows.
- Depth vs Clarity: Overloading content kills AEO. Focus on clear, segmented content chunks.
- Coverage vs Focus: Don’t try to cover every keyword at once. Prioritize high-intent, high-value topics.

Where AI Automation Fits and Where It Doesn’t
AI-powered tools can scrape keyword data, suggest content outlines, and assist with structured data implementation. Use them to accelerate research and technical SEO tasks.
However, do not rely on AI to write final content for regulated verticals without human expertise and legal review. Compliance nuances and tone are too critical to automate fully.
